#812828 Color
#812828 is rgb(129, 40, 40) in RGB, hsl(0, 53%, 33%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 69%, 69%, 49%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Persian Plum (#701C1C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.7.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#812828 Channel Values
How #812828 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 129 · G 40 · B 40 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 0° · S 53% · L 33%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 0° · S 69% · V 51%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 69% · Y 69% · K 49%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 9.26:1 vs white · 2.27: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#812828 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#812828 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#812828?
#812828 is a dark red — rgb(129, 40, 40) in RGB and hsl(0, 53%, 33%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Persian Plum (#701C1C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.7.
What is the RGB value of #812828?
#812828 is rgb(129, 40, 40) — red 129, green 40, and blue 40 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#812828?
#812828 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 69%, 69%, 49%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#812828 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#812828 scores 9.26:1 against white and 2.27: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#812828 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#812828 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is brown (#A52A2A) at a CIE76 distance of 16.65, which is visibly different.
